How they compare
Cambodia currently reports 183,130 tonnes against 151,079 tonnes in Canada, a difference of 32,051 tonnes.
That makes Cambodia's figure about 1.2 times Canada's.
The two have swapped places 3 times across 28 shared years of data; in 1991 it was Canada ahead.
Cambodia ranks 23rd and Canada ranks 26th of 111 countries.

About this data
Bottom trawling is a fishing method in which a large, heavy net is dragged along the seafloor to catch fish and other marine life.
